	html {
          scrollbar-face-color: #f3f1d8;
		  scrollbar-highlight-color: #9b8633;
		  scrollbar-shadow-color: #9b8633;
		  scrollbar-darkshadow-color: #9b8633;
		  scrollbar-3dlight-color: #454844;
		  scrollbar-track-color: #f3f1d8;
		  scrollbar-arrow-color: #9b8633;
	}
	body {  
		 background: #fff url(img/bgpag.jpg) repeat scroll 0% 0%;
		 color: #000;
		 border: 0px solid #c9b50d;
		 }
		 
	#pagina{ overflow: hidden;
		 width: 800px;
		 margin-left: auto;
		 margin-right: auto;
         border: 0px solid #c9b50d;
		 }
	
	#top{
		overflow: hidden;
		margin-bottom: 5px;
		height: 150px;
		border: 0px solid #c9b50d;
		color: #fff;
		background: #f6e1aa url(img/top2.JPG) no-repeat scroll 0% 0%;	
		}
		
	ul#menu{text-align: center;
		  padding: 5px;
		  font: bold 14px "bookman old style", Arial;
		  margin-left: 0px;
		  margin-top: 0px;
		  border: 2px dotted #c9b50d;
		  white-space: nowrap;
		  }
		   
	#menu li{
		  	 display: inline;
			 margin-left: 5px;
		  	 list-style-type: none;
			 border-right: 0px solid black;
			 }
			 
	#menu a.nav, 
	#menu a.nav:link, 
	#menu a.nav:visited{
		  				padding-left: 20px;
                        padding-right: 2px;
                        padding-top: 2px;
                        padding-bottom: 2px;
						margin: 0px;
						text-decoration: none;
						color: #a58029; 
                        border: 1px solid #c9b50d;
   						background: #f6e1aa url(img/bga.jpg) no-repeat scroll 0% 50%;
						}
	

	#menu a.nav:hover,
	#menu a.nav:active{
		  	padding-left: 20px;
			padding-right: 2px;
			padding-top: 2px;
            padding-bottom: 2px;
			margin: 0px;
			text-decoration: underline;
			color: #477742;
			border: 1px solid #c9b50d;
  			background: #f6e1aa url(img/bga.jpg) no-repeat scroll 0% 50%;	
			}
			
	#menu a.act{
		  	padding-left: 20px;
			padding-right: 2px;
			padding-top: 2px;
            padding-bottom: 2px;
			margin: 0px;
			text-decoration: underline;
			color: #477742;
			border: 1px solid #c9b50d;
   			background: #f6e1aa url(img/bga.jpg) no-repeat scroll 0% 50%;	
			}

	.box{
		 float: left;
		 width: 255px;
		 margin-left: 5px;
		 margin-top: 5px;
		 border: 0px solid #c9b50d;
		 overflow: hidden;
		 }

	.box h3{
		  	 text-align: center;
		  	 color: #b58002;
			 background-color: #fff;
		 	}

	.box h4{text-align: center;
		  	 color: #477742;
			 border: 1px solid #c9b50d;
			 background-color: #fff;
		  	 }

	.box a{
		  color: #b58002;
		  background-color: #fff;
		  }
	.box a:hover{
		  color: #b58002;
		  background-color: #e1f4c6;
		  }

	.box .testa{
			overflow: hidden;
			font: bold 14px  Helvetica, sans-serif, Arial;
			color: #ffffff;
			width: 255px;
			height: 26px;
			padding-left: 0px;
			padding-top: 10px;
			text-align: center;
			background: #6fbd03 url(img/testa.jpg) no-repeat scroll 0% 0%;
			border: 0px solid #c9b50d;
		}

	.box .text .icopd{margin-left: 5px;
		  list-style-image:url(img/schedlog.jpg);
		  list-style-position:outside;
		  }
	
	.box .text .icopt{margin-left: 5px;
		  list-style-image:url(img/ptartlog.jpg); 
		  list-style-position:outside;
		  }
	
	.box .piede{overflow: hidden;
			width: 255px;
			height: 20px;
			color: #ffffff;
			background: #6fbd03 url(img/pie.jpg) no-repeat scroll 0% 0%;
			border: 0px solid #c9b50d;
	}
	
	.box .text{
		  font: 0.9em Helvetica, sans-serif, Arial;
		  height: 450px;
		  color: #757575;
		  padding: 10px;
		  background: #ffffff url(img/boxbg.jpg) repeat-y scroll 0% 0%;		
		  }
	
	 .text2{float:left;
	 		margin: 10px;
			font: 0.9em Helvetica, sans-serif, Arial;
		  	color: #757575;
			border: 2px dotted #c9b50d;
			padding: 5px;
		  	background: #fff;		
			}
			
	.text2 h3{
		  	 text-align: center;
		  	 color: #b58002;
			 background-color: #fff;	
		 	}
	
	.text2 h4{text-align: center;
		  	 color: #477742;
			 border: 1px solid #c9b50d;
			 background-color: #fff;	
		  	 }
			
	.text2 input{
		  		border: 1px solid #b58002;
				font: bold 13px  Helvetica, sans-serif, Arial;
				color: #3c5b2d;
				background-color: #fff;	
	}
	
	.text2 textarea{
		  		   overflow: auto;
		  		   border: 1px solid #b58002;
				   font: 13px  Helvetica, sans-serif, Arial;
				   color: #3c5b2d;
				   background-color: #fff;		
				  }		 
	
	ul#left, #left li{
		 font: bold 14px book antiqua, Helvetica, Arial;
		 float: left;
		 width: 180px;
		 margin-bottom: 10px;
		 padding: 0;
		 overflow: hidden;
		 list-style-type: none;
		  }
		  
	#left a.nav,
	#left a.nav:link,
	#left a.nav:visited{
		  	text-align: left;
		  	display: block;
			color: #0d450b;
			padding: 5px;
			background:#fff url(img/bgpag.jpg) repeat scroll 0% 0%;
			}
	#left a.nav:hover{
		  	text-align: left;
		  	color: #0d450b;
			padding: 5px;
			background: url(img/bgla.jpg) no-repeat scroll 0% 50%;
		  	}
	
	#left a.act{
		  	text-align: left;
		  	display: block;
			color: #0d450b;
			padding: 5px;
			background: url(img/bgla.jpg) no-repeat scroll 100% 50%;
		  	}
	
	#content{
			float: right;
			width: 600px;   
	    	padding: 5px;
			margin-left: 0px;
			margin-right: 0px;
			border: 1px solid #dadada;
			background-color: #fff;
			color: #757575;
			}
	#content a{
		  color: #b58002;
		  background-color: #fff;
		  }
	#content a:hover{
		  color: #b58002;
		  background-color: #e1f4c6;
		  }			 
	.prod{
		  float: left;
		  border-bottom: 1px solid #b58002;
		  padding-bottom: 5px;
		}
	
	.prod .int{
			 	   float: left;
				   padding: 4px;
				   margin-top: 10px;
				   width: 185px; 
				   color: #77652d;
				   background: #fff;
				   }
				  
	.prod .int h3{
			 	   		   text-align: center;
			 	   		   font: bold 16px Georgia, Times New Roman, Times;
						   margin: 0;
				   		   }
				   
	.box2{
		 clear: left;
		 margin: 5px 5px;
		 padding: 10px 5px; 
		 border-bottom: 2px dotted #c9b50d;
		 overflow: hidden;
		 background: #fff;
		 color: #616161;
		 }
		 
	.box2 h3{
		  	 text-align: center;
		  	 color: #b58002;
			 background-color: #fff;	
		 	}
	.box2 h3.cbr{
	height: 50px;
	background: url(img/logocbr.jpg) no-repeat scroll 10px 50%;
	font-size: 36px;
	padding-left: 20px;
		  	 	  }
	
	.box2 h4{
		  	 color: #477742;
			 background-color: #fff;	
		  	 }
	
	.box3{
	clear: left;
	text-align: center;
	margin: 5px 5px;
	padding: 10px 5px;
	border: 0px solid #c9b50d;
	overflow: hidden;
	background: #fff;
	color: #616161;
	z-index: 5;
		 }
		 
	.box3 a{
		 clear: left;
		 text-align: center;
		 margin: 5px 5px;
		 padding: 5px; 
		 border: 1px solid #c9b50d;
		 overflow: hidden;
		 background: #fff;
		 color: #616161;
		 }
		 
	.box3 a:hover{
	color: #b58002;
	background-color: #e1f4c6;
	z-index: 5;
		  } 
					
	#content p{float: left;
			   font: 13px book antiqua, Helvetica, Arial;
			   width: 149px;
			   height: 200px;
			   border: 0px solid #c9b50d;
			   text-align: center;
			   margin: 10px; 
			   }
	#content td{
			    color: #77652d;
				background-color: #fff;
			 	}

	#content td.green{
			 background-color: #d3f4c6;
			 color: #484a4a;
			 margin: 2px;
			 }
	#content td.grey{
			 background-color: #e6e6e6;
			 height: 20px;
			 color: #484a4a;
			 margin: 2px;
	}

    #bottom{
		clear: both;
		text-align: center;
		font: 13px/16px garmond, Arial;
        margin-top: 20px;
		padding: 5px;
		color: #477742; 
		background: #f6e1aa url(img/bgpag.jpg) repeat scroll 0% 0%;
		border: 2px dotted #c9b50d;
	}
 
 	

